Server Room with Blue Lighting.
Schlüsselwörter
network,
technology,
cyberspace,
infrastructure,
digital,
computing,
hardware,
datum,
processing,
storage,
high technology,
futuristic,
modern,
security,
system,
data processing,
software,
computer network,
high speed,
database,
server room,
hosting,
data storage,
cloud